Bugfix #28109
Old issue with OSX Cocoa code: shift+scrollwheel should send
a 'horizontal wheel' event to Blender. Blender only recognizes
scroll events in general though. The old code then just didn't
send an event at all, not passing on shift+scrolls.
Now the scroll event is sent anyway, relying on Blender's
keymapping to define what to do with shift+scroll.
This fixes things like shift+scroll to scale ListBox widgets.
